charlsmcfarlane Posted October 7, 2023 Share Posted October 7, 2023 I've seen many sellers ask for a way to have the revision number defined in the gig/offer actually relate to the buyer's ability to perpetually click "request revision". I really hope that Fiverr looks into this and makes this system work better. Regardless of whether this system changes, it would be great to have a way to communicate to the buyer what constitutes a revision. This can be done in the description, but they aren't always read by the buyer. It would be great if a seller could write some copy that displays to the buyer when requesting a revision. This would adequately set the expectation before the buyer submits the revision request. I'd like to be able to define what's included in a revision and also let them know to be as clear and complete as they can with their feedback as further changes will be chargeable.
